5 Amazing things and people we didn't know(INDIAN FACTS)

1. Dr. Shrikant Jichkar holds the record for “World’s most qualified person”. He was an IAS, IPS, lawyer, doctor(MMBS, MD),  D. Litt (Doctor of Letters) in Sanskrit the highest degree in a University, photographer, actor, radio operator, youngest MLA(MP,MLC,etc..) at the age of 25, held 14 portfolios(at a time), had 20 degrees(9 MA), 28 gold medals & had a library of 52,000 books. In 2004 when he died in Car accident, he got approx. 30 Cr insurance.


2.  India and Bangladesh share a 3rd enclave border which means that a part of India is in Bangladesh which is in India which is in Bangladesh. Phew!




03. The Income Tax Rate in India was 97.75% in the year 1973( Totally 11 slabs).


04.  In 1948, the Nobel Peace Prize was not awarded. It would have been awarded to Mahatma Gandhi, however, due to his assassination; it was left unassigned in his honour.


05 . Narayana Murthy was a self-proclaimed socialist, but during his visit to Bulgaria, he was arrested and put in jail for talking against the Bulgarian govt. The experience pulled him towards capitalism and he learnt that entrepreneurship and job creation is the way to alleviate poverty. He then founded Infosys.

Service Tax

Surprisingly after reading about
the "Service Tax", I strongly decided to share this information to
everyone.
This happened at the restaurant. Let me explain.
We had been to several restaurants recently. I observed that "service tax" has been mis-used and charged to the customers like you and me.
Let me give an example.
Food and Beverage = Rs. 1000.00
Service Charges @ 10% = Rs. 100.00 (10% on the Food and beverage amount)
Service Tax @ 4.94% = Rs. 54.34 (4.94% on F&B + Service Charges)
VAT @14.5% = Rs. 145.00
Total = Rs. 1299.34
As per the definition - "Service Tax can be charged only for the services provided to the customer".
Now, see what is happening here in the above said example.
Service Tax should be charged only on the Service Charges amount i.e Rs.100 and not on the entire amount (1000+100).
In this example, the customer should be charged only Rs 4.94, whereas he has been charged
Rs. 49.00 extra.
Where does this money go? Only the restaurant owner and the chartered accountants who work for them know.
